Occupying the same four-acre riverside site since 1673, Chelsea Physic Garden was established by the Worshipful Society of Apothecaries to grow medicinal plants, develop remedies and train apprentices in the physic or healing arts.
Chiswick Pier Trust works to engage people with the River Thames. We provide access to the Thames and support major river events, as well as organising events of our own. We also host an annual season of ‘Talks by the Thames’ which highlight the history, wildlife and ecology of the Thames. The Chiswick Pier Trust runs the Chiswick Pier and Pier House. In this role we manage the commercial and residential moorings at the Pier, as well as venue and conference hire at Pier House.
Richmond Park is in the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ames. The park was created by Charles I in the 17th century as a deer park. Richmond Park is the largest of London's Royal Parks, is of national and international importance for wildlife conservation and is a national nature reserve.
